    Quote Originally Posted by Rein_eon_Osborne View Post
    5. In general, yes. But in dungeon runs, it's generally preferred to just save your longer cooldowns for wall pulls because that's where most of the damage a tank will receive. Using the 90s ones early on a boss encounter because it'll come back up when that boss dies, but your short, auxiliary cooldowns are best used here to deal with tankbusters and whatnot. Those are enough. The amount of time I have to rub my temple when I see a PLD pop up Sentinel when the boss is at 5% HP just because the boss is casting tankbuster could probably make me a rich man if I get 3 dollar each time that happens. No, just save it for the upcoming pulls. We also regenerate 10% HP/MP every 3s outside combat, remember? It's fine if the tank finishes at sub 50% HP. Nothing's gonna kill them right off the bat.
    This literally made me cringe also...as PLD main tank (used to be WAR). Sentinel in dungeons is so damn useful on w2w. I don't think I have ever used sentinel on a boss...like ever...
    Holy Sheltron is literally the same thing....and in a tank buster situation is MUCH more efficient to use for the single hit TB as it's only 4 seconds at 30% then reduces to 15%. You don't need 15s of 30% mitigation for a single hit tank buster...healers have so much in their kit to insta heal me to 100%. Sentinel is better served as a mitigation for 10 mobs chomping on your ass.

    Holy Sheltron is probably the strongest mitigation in the game imo....but i'm biased. 50 oath for a on demand sentinel is ridiculous, and a clemency level HoT to boot.

    TBN is great but MP on DRK is precious as you have to decide to DPS or mitigate with your MP. Also you have to hope it breaks.
    Bloodwhetting is great, but I got better return while coupling it with my burst. Great skill and mit...but MUCH more ridiculous during burst.
    Heart of Corundum is amazing and would be a STRONG 2nd place, but if you don't hit 50% HP it just kind of misses the mark. Still on demand Excog is nice though.

    Holy Sheltron is just...fire and forget....no gimmick...no hoops...just use it and enjoy 30% mit for 4 seconds 15% for another 4 seconds and 1000 potency heal over 12 seconds (250 every server tick). I have used Holy Sheltron literally by itself for tank busters in savage and it was enough mitigation. Tier 2 and Tier 3 pushed me away from doing this as SE added bleeds/dots that last FOREVER. Which is fine...I like the challenge and healers really have to plan ahead for every tank buster...which is better then mashing a single button.

    Tanks really have to know their mits and which is used for certain situations.
